  • Question 1
    1 / -0
    Which of the following salts does not contain water of crystallisation?
    Solution
    Blue vitriol is copper(II) sulphate pentahydrate $$({ CuSO }_{ 4 }.5{ H }_{ 2 }O)$$.

    Baking soda is sodium bicarbonate without any water of crystallization $$(NaH{ CO }_{ 3 })$$.

    Washing soda is sodium carbonate decahydrate $$({ Na }_{ 2 }{ CO }_{ 3 }. 10{ H }_{ 2 }O)$$.  

    Gypsum is a mineral composed of calcium sulphate dihydrate $$({ CaSO }_{ 4 }.2{ H }_{ 2 }O)$$.

  • Question 5
    1 / -0
    Bleaching powder is obtained by the reaction of $$Cl_{2}$$ with:
    Solution
    Bleaching powder is produced by the action of chlorine on dry slaked lime $$Ca(OH)_2$$
    $$2Cl_2 + 2Ca(OH)_2 \rightarrow Ca(OCl)_2 + CaCl_2 + 2H_2O$$
                                       $$ Bleaching\ powder$$
    Thus, Option $$D$$ is correct
  • Question 6
    1 / -0
    When an acid reacts with a metal carbonate or metal hydrogen carbonate, it gives the corresponding salt, gas and product. Name the gas and product?
    Solution
    Acid + Metal carbonate  $$\longrightarrow$$ Salt + Water + Carbon dioxide.

    The gas is carbon dioxide and the product is water.

    Example-
    CaCO$$_3$$ (calcium carbonate-metal carbonate) + 2HCl $$\longrightarrow$$ CaCl$$_2$$ (calcium chloride-salt) + H$$_2$$O + CO$$_2$$

    Hence, option A is correct.

  • Question 10
    1 / -0
    The $$pH$$ of blood is:
    Solution
    Blood is normally slightly basic, with a normal $$pH$$ range of $$7.35$$ to $$7.45$$. Usually the body maintains the $$pH$$ of blood close to $$7.40$$.
